Benefits of Renewable Energy in EV Charging
Utilizing renewable energy for charging EVs offers numerous advantages, including reduced carbon emissions, lower operational costs, and enhanced energy independence. These benefits align with the growing demand for environmentally-friendly products.
Innovative Charging Solutions
Manufacturers are increasingly developing innovative charging solutions that harness renewable energy, such as solar-powered charging stations. These advancements not only appeal to eco-conscious consumers but also create new market opportunities.
Policy Support for Renewable Integration
Many governments worldwide are introducing policies to incentivize the integration of renewable energy in the EV sector. Suppliers and manufacturers should stay informed about these initiatives to leverage potential funding and support.
Challenges and Considerations
While the benefits are significant, challenges remain in integrating renewable energy into existing charging infrastructures. Manufacturers must address issues related to energy storage, grid connectivity, and initial investment costs.
